At the heart of these encounters is asymmetry: differences in language, social norms, and expectations create space for both friction and delight. For example, a Western traveler’s loud enthusiasm may be read as rudeness in Thailand’s more reserved social code, while a local’s teasing or indirectness can bewilder someone used to direct communication. Yet these gaps also generate laughter and curiosity—two essential ingredients of cultural exchange. "Ding dong" suggests not just error but a joyful bell-like reminder that learning across cultures often proceeds through trial, embarrassment, and eventual adaptation.

Originally derived from the Persian word for "Frank" (referring to the Germanic people who occupied Gaul), this is the common Thai term for Caucasians. It is also the word for guava fruit , leading to a popular local joke that foreigners are just "big guavas". At the heart of these encounters is asymmetry:
